A sport where two opponents attempt to subdue each other in bare-handed grappling using techniques of leverage, holding, and pressure points.
Wrestling at the 2016 Summer Olympics
(countable, dated) A wrestling match.
Detail of Ancient Egyptian wrestling scenes in tomb 15 (Baqet III) at Beni Hasan, c. 20th century BC
(countable) The act of one who wrestles; a struggle to achieve something.
